Calling all Filipino Dua Lipa fans! Get ready to mark your calendars and dust off your dancing shoes because the British pop icon is returning to Manila! This 13 Nov 2024, Lipa will be gracing the Philippine Arena stage as part of her “Radical Optimism” Asia Tour. The concert is surely something you don’t want to miss!

This Manila concert marks Lipa’s first Philippine performance since 2018, and fans are undoubtedly eager to see her live again. The Philippine Arena, one of the world’s largest indoor arenas, promises a spectacular venue for this highly anticipated event.

This concert is your chance to experience Dua Lipa live, belting out her latest hits like “Houdini,” “Training Season,” and “Illusion” from her recently released album “Radical Optimism.” But don’t worry, Lipa is also known for treating fans to her chart-topping anthems like “New Rules,” “Levitating,” and “Don’t Start Now.”
